web.xml文件代码
时间: 2024-09-23 07:13:57 浏览: 51
web.xml文件是Java Servlet规范中定义的一个XML配置文件,它位于Web应用程序的根目录下(通常与`src/main/webapp`同级),主要用于配置Servlet、Filter、Listener等组件以及设定HTTP请求的映射规则。下面是一个简单的web.xml示例:
```xml
<?xml version="1.0" encoding="UTF-8"?>
<web-app x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xmlns="http://xmlns.jcp.org/xml/ns/javaee"
xsi:schemaLocation="http://xmlns.jcp.org/xml/ns/javaee http://xmlns.jcp.org/xml/ns/javaee/web-app_4_0.xsd"
version="4.0">
<!-- 标识Servlet -->
<servlet>
<servlet-name>HelloWorldServlet</servlet-name>
<servlet-class>com.example.HelloWorldServlet</servlet-class>
</servlet>
<!-- 配置Servlet映射 -->
<servlet-mapping>
<servlet-name>HelloWorldServlet</servlet-name>
<url-pattern>/hello</url-pattern>
</servlet-mapping>
</web-app>
```
在这个例子中,定义了一个名为`HelloWorldServlet`的Servlet,并将其映射到路径`/hello`上。当用户访问这个URL时,会触发该Servlet处理。
阅读全文